Step 8 is dedicated to individual "Trainer Training," and includes personal assessments of subject knowledge and your ability to pass it on.
This takes into account individual learning and teaching abilities.
On successful completion of the Step 8 training you will either
receive your Taoist Trainer Licence right away to teach Steps 1 to 3 without any further post-requirements,
or be asked to repeat/assist specific course/s to reach an acceptable teaching standard.
For the sake of clarity, outcomes will be defined so that everyone knows and can agree on standards.
Pre-requisites for Step 8 are a) to have attained Taoist Practitioner (TP) status and
b) after attaining TP, one series of assisting once on each of Steps 1 to 5,
plus Taoist Shamanic Healing and the Tai Chi summer camp
You will have already taken most of the Steps to achieve Taoist Practitioner status:
after completing Step 5 you take a simple assessment of your ability to:
demonstrate the Tai Chi form and explain the applications;
demonstrate and explain the basic structures of Iron Shirt Chi Kung;
demonstrate an understanding of and ability to explain and demonstrate the Jade Circle or Jade Arrows practices.
In summary: A Taoist Practitioner will have completed Steps 1 to 5 and, after successful assessment, be authorised to teach Basic Tai Chi, Intermediate Chi Kung, and Jade Circle or Jade Arrows.
A Taoist Trainer will have assisted on Steps 1 to 5, Taoist Shamanic Healing and Tai Chi Summer Camp, and, after satisfactorily completing Step 8 Training & Assessment, receive the London Tao Centre Trainer Licence to teach Steps 1 to 3.
